區塊鏈核心算法解析+區塊鏈開發指南+區塊鏈技術指南 +區塊鏈技術原理及底層架構 4本

區塊鏈核心算法解析+區塊鏈開發指南+區塊鏈技術指南 +區塊鏈技術原理及底層架構 4本 下載 mobi epub pdf 電子書 2025

圖書標籤:
  • 區塊鏈
  • 核心算法
  • 開發指南
  • 技術原理
  • 底層架構
  • 密碼學
  • 分布式係統
  • 共識機製
  • 智能閤約
  • 數字貨幣
想要找書就要到 圖書大百科
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!
店鋪: 藍墨水圖書專營店
齣版社: 電子工業齣版社
ISBN:9787121313288
商品編碼:1626395430
齣版時間:2017-08-01

具體描述

《區塊鏈:加密、共識與智能閤約》 簡介: 本書深度剖析區塊鏈技術的底層運行邏輯,旨在為讀者構建一個全麵且紮實的區塊鏈知識體係。我們不局限於對現有區塊鏈框架的簡單介紹,而是從核心的加密學原理齣發,逐步深入到分布式共識機製的演進與實現,再到智能閤約的編程範式與安全考量。本書的目標是讓讀者不僅知其然,更知其所以然,能夠理解區塊鏈技術為何能夠實現去中心化、不可篡改和透明等特性,並為未來區塊鏈技術的創新與應用打下堅實基礎。 第一部分:加密學基石——區塊鏈的安全保障 區塊鏈的強大安全屬性,很大程度上源於其對先進加密學原理的巧妙運用。本部分將深入淺齣地講解構成區塊鏈安全體係的核心加密技術。 哈希函數:數據的指紋與完整性校驗 我們將詳細介紹各類密碼學哈希函數(如SHA-256)的數學原理,包括其單嚮性(難以從哈希值逆推齣原始數據)、抗碰撞性(難以找到兩個不同的輸入産生相同的哈希值)以及雪崩效應(輸入微小變化導緻輸齣巨大變化)等關鍵特性。 闡述哈希函數在區塊鏈中的具體應用,例如:如何通過 Merkle Tree(默剋爾樹)高效驗證交易數據的完整性,以及如何用於生成區塊的唯一標識符(區塊哈希)。我們將展示交易信息被哈希成交易ID,再通過 Merkle Tree 聚閤,最終與區塊頭中的 Merkle Root 相關聯的完整流程,解釋為何任何對交易的篡改都會立即被檢測齣來。 分析哈希函數在生成地址、以及作為工作量證明(Proof-of-Work, PoW)算法中的關鍵組成部分所扮演的角色。 非對稱加密:數字簽名與身份驗證 本部分將詳細講解公鑰密碼學(Public-Key Cryptography)的基本原理,包括公鑰和私鑰的生成、公鑰加密與私鑰解密(用於數據加密)、以及私鑰簽名與公鑰驗證(用於數字簽名)的工作機製。 重點闡述數字簽名在區塊鏈中的重要性。我們將詳細解析一筆交易是如何通過發送方的私鑰進行簽名,以及其他節點如何利用發送方的公鑰來驗證簽名的有效性,從而確認交易的真實性和發送方的身份,防止僞造交易。 介紹橢圓麯綫數字簽名算法(ECDSA)等在區塊鏈領域廣泛應用的具體算法,並簡要分析其數學基礎和安全性。 探討公鑰如何被用於生成區塊鏈地址,以及私鑰在管理數字資産中的關鍵作用。 數字證書與身份管理(概述): 雖然區塊鏈本身通過公鑰和私鑰實現瞭高度的身份驗證,但我們將簡要提及在某些需要更強身份約束的應用場景中,數字證書(如 X.509)如何與區塊鏈技術結閤,以實現更復雜的身份管理和信任機製。但這部分內容將側重於概念性的介紹,而非深入的證書管理技術細節。 第二部分:分布式共識——去中心化網絡的基石 區塊鏈最核心的魅力在於其去中心化的特性,而實現這一特性的關鍵在於各種分布式共識算法。本部分將深入探討這些算法的原理、演進以及各自的優缺點。 共識問題的挑戰與演進 首先,我們將明確分布式係統中“拜占庭將軍問題”(Byzantine Generals Problem)的挑戰,即在不可靠的網絡環境中,如何讓所有誠實節點就某個狀態達成一緻。 迴顧早期分布式共識算法的嘗試,為理解現代共識機製的齣現奠定基礎。 工作量證明(Proof-of-Work, PoW):比特幣的基石 本書將詳細解析 PoW 的工作原理,包括挖礦過程、難度調整機製以及中本聰共識(Nakamoto Consensus)的五十一攻擊(51% Attack)防範機製。 我們將深入探討 PoW 的優缺點:其高度的穩定性和安全性,但也伴隨著巨大的能源消耗和較低的交易吞吐量。 通過圖示和實例,清晰展示礦工如何競爭計算特定哈希值的過程,以及區塊鏈如何通過最長鏈原則來解決分叉問題。 權益證明(Proof-of-Stake, PoS)及其變種:效率與可持續性的探索 我們將深入分析 PoS 的基本原理,即根據節點持有的代幣數量和時間來決定其産生區塊的權利,從而替代 PoW 的計算力競爭。 詳細介紹 PoS 的優勢,如更低的能源消耗、更高的交易吞吐量以及更低的入門門檻。 講解 PoS 的潛在風險,例如“富者愈富”的中心化傾嚮,以及“長程攻擊”(Long-range Attack)等問題。 我們將重點介紹幾種主流的 PoS 變種,如委托權益證明(Delegated Proof-of-Stake, DPoS)、混閤權益證明(Hybrid PoS)等,分析它們在解決 PoS 固有問題上的創新之處。 其他共識機製的概述與比較: 本書還將簡要介紹其他重要的共識機製,如權威證明(Proof-of-Authority, PoA)、拜占庭容錯(Byzantine Fault Tolerance, BFT)及其變種(如 PBFT, Tendermint),以及許可鏈常用的共識機製。 通過對比分析,幫助讀者理解不同共識機製的適用場景、性能特點以及安全性權衡。 第三部分:智能閤約——賦能去中心化應用的邏輯 智能閤約是區塊鏈技術實現復雜應用的關鍵。本部分將聚焦於智能閤約的原理、編程模型以及安全實踐。 智能閤約的定義與核心理念 我們將清晰界定智能閤約的概念,強調其“代碼即法律”的特性,以及在區塊鏈上自動執行、不可篡改的優勢。 解釋智能閤約如何通過預設的條件觸發,自動執行協議條款,無需第三方中介。 以太坊虛擬機(EVM)與 Solidity 語言 作為最成功的智能閤約平颱,我們將深入剖析以太坊虛擬機(EVM)的工作原理,包括其狀態機模型、Gas 機製以及閤約的部署與執行流程。 重點講解 Solidity 語言,這是以太坊上最主流的智能閤約編程語言。我們將介紹 Solidity 的語法結構、數據類型、函數、事件以及繼承等核心概念,並通過簡單的代碼示例來演示如何編寫智能閤約。 我們將演示如何通過 Solidity 編寫一個簡單的代幣閤約(如 ERC-20 標準),以及一個基本的投票閤約,展示智能閤約在實際應用中的潛力。 智能閤約的應用場景探索 本書將概述智能閤約在金融(DeFi)、供應鏈管理、身份驗證、遊戲、去中心化自治組織(DAO)等領域的廣泛應用潛力。 通過分析具體案例,展示智能閤約如何重塑傳統行業,提升效率,降低成本,並創造新的商業模式。 智能閤約的安全挑戰與最佳實踐 智能閤約一旦部署,就難以修改,其安全性至關重要。本部分將詳細分析智能閤約常見的安全漏洞,例如重入攻擊(Reentrancy Attack)、整數溢齣(Integer Overflow/Underflow)、訪問控製不當、以及邏輯錯誤等。 我們將介紹一係列智能閤約的安全審計方法和最佳實踐,包括代碼審查、形式化驗證、模糊測試以及使用安全庫等,旨在幫助開發者編寫更安全、更可靠的智能閤約。 我們將強調安全意識在智能閤約開發中的首要地位。 第四部分:區塊鏈的未來展望與技術前沿(概述) 在掌握瞭區塊鏈的核心技術後,本書將簡要展望區塊鏈技術的未來發展方嚮,並介紹一些前沿的研究領域。 擴展性解決方案(Layer 2): 簡要介紹當前區塊鏈麵臨的“不可能三角”挑戰(可擴展性、安全性和去中心化難以兼顧),並概述 Layer 2 擴展性解決方案,如狀態通道(State Channels)、側鏈(Sidechains)、Rollups(Optimistic Rollups and ZK-Rollups)等,解釋它們如何提升區塊鏈的交易吞吐量和速度。 跨鏈互操作性: 探討不同區塊鏈之間如何進行安全、高效的通信和資産轉移,以及實現跨鏈資産和信息的流動。 隱私保護技術: 簡要介紹零知識證明(Zero-Knowledge Proofs)等隱私保護技術在區塊鏈領域的應用,以及如何平衡透明性與隱私性。 區塊鏈與其他技術的融閤: 展望區塊鏈與人工智能(AI)、物聯網(IoT)、大數據等技術的結閤,可能帶來的顛覆性創新。 總結: 《區塊鏈:加密、共識與智能閤約》旨在為讀者提供一個深入、係統且易於理解的區塊鏈技術學習路徑。本書的核心目標是 empowering 讀者,使其不僅能夠理解區塊鏈的“是什麼”,更能深刻洞察其“為什麼”和“如何做”,從而具備分析、評估和參與區塊鏈技術開發與應用的能力。我們相信,通過掌握本書的內容,讀者將能夠更好地理解當前區塊鏈生態係統的運作,並為未來的技術創新和商業實踐做好準備。

用戶評價

評分

這套書的內容質量真的很高,遠超我的預期。我特彆喜歡《區塊鏈技術原理及底層架構》這本書,它將區塊鏈的底層技術講得非常透徹。我一直想弄明白,為什麼節點之間能夠保持一緻性,為什麼數據能夠被如此安全地記錄下來。這本書詳細講解瞭P2P網絡通信、數據一緻性協議(如Paxos、Raft的原理及在區塊鏈中的應用)、以及各種加密算法在其中的作用。讀完之後,我感覺自己像是擁有瞭一張區塊鏈的“瑞士軍刀”,能夠從技術的根源上去理解這個復雜的係統。然後,我迫不及待地翻閱瞭《區塊鏈開發指南》。這本書的實用性極強,它不僅僅是理論的堆砌,而是提供瞭大量的代碼示例和實踐指導。我跟著書中的步驟,成功地搭建瞭一個自己的區塊鏈節點,並且嘗試部署瞭一個智能閤約。雖然一開始有些生疏,但書中的提示非常及時和準確,讓我能夠順利地完成操作。這對於我來說,是一種非常寶貴的學習經曆,它讓我不再僅僅是理論的學習者,而是能夠親手去構建和探索。

評分

我必須承認,在閱讀這套書之前,我對區塊鏈的理解停留在“金融科技”的層麵,認為它隻是比特幣的代名詞。然而,這四本書徹底顛覆瞭我的認知。《區塊鏈技術指南》讓我看到瞭區塊鏈技術的廣闊應用前景,它不僅僅局限於金融領域,在供應鏈管理、版權保護、身份認證、醫療保健等等方麵,都有著巨大的潛力。書中列舉的案例讓我大開眼界,原來區塊鏈可以解決這麼多現實世界中的痛點。讓我印象深刻的是,它在介紹這些應用場景時,並沒有過於誇大其詞,而是客觀地分析瞭其優勢和局限性,這種嚴謹的態度讓我非常信服。而《區塊鏈核心算法解析》則是我最先翻閱的部分,它如同一個引路人,將我帶入瞭區塊鏈的“心髒”。我之前對加密學一竅不通,但這本書通過生動形象的比喻和循序漸進的講解,讓我理解瞭公鑰私鑰的原理、數字簽名的安全性以及共識機製的演變。比如,它解釋PoW和PoS時,不僅僅是給齣公式,而是深入剖析瞭它們的設計哲學和各自的優缺點,讓我能夠從更高的維度去理解區塊鏈的魯棒性。

評分

這套書的組閤簡直是絕瞭!我之前接觸過一些區塊鏈的入門書籍,但總感覺浮於錶麵,對於“為什麼”和“怎麼做”的解釋不夠深入。這次的這四本書,從不同的角度切入,形成瞭一個非常完整的知識體係。比如,在讀《區塊鏈技術原理及底層架構》的時候,我被它嚴謹的邏輯和對技術細節的深入剖析所震撼。它不僅僅是講概念,而是追根溯源,告訴你每一個設計背後都有其必然的邏輯和權衡。它詳細講解瞭節點的通信方式、數據的存儲結構、交易的驗證流程等等,這些都是構成區塊鏈安全性和去中心化特性的基石。我一直很好奇,為什麼區塊鏈能夠做到不可篡改,讀瞭這本書之後,我纔真正理解瞭哈希函數、 Merkle Tree 和分布式賬本的妙用。而《區塊鏈開發指南》則像是給原理注入瞭生命,它將那些抽象的概念轉化為瞭可執行的代碼。我以前認為區塊鏈開發是非常高大上的事情,需要很強的編程功底,但這本書的例子非常貼閤實際,讓我覺得即便是初學者,隻要跟著步驟操作,也能有所收獲。我嘗試著去部署一個簡單的去中心化應用(DApp),雖然過程中遇到瞭一些挑戰,但書中的講解讓我能夠找到解決問題的方法,而不是一籌莫展。

評分

坦白說,我原本以為這套書會是枯燥的技術堆砌,但沒想到讀起來卻非常有意思,而且受益匪淺。《區塊鏈技術指南》為我打開瞭新世界的大門,它展示瞭區塊鏈技術在各個領域的創新應用,讓我看到瞭一個充滿想象力的未來。書中對一些前沿技術的探討,比如跨鏈技術、側鏈、以及未來的發展趨勢,都讓我思考良多。它不僅僅是介紹“是什麼”,更是引導我去思考“為什麼會是這樣”以及“未來會怎樣”。而《區塊鏈核心算法解析》則是我理解區塊鏈“靈魂”的關鍵。我一直對密碼學很感興趣,這本書將它與區塊鏈完美地結閤在瞭一起。它解釋瞭數字簽名如何保證交易的真實性和不可否認性,共識機製又是如何解決分布式係統中的信任問題。特彆是對拜占庭將軍問題以及不同共識算法的優劣分析,讓我對區塊鏈的健壯性有瞭更深刻的認識。我發現,很多看似復雜的技術,其實都源於一些巧妙的設計和嚴謹的邏輯。這本書讓我覺得,學習區塊鏈技術,不僅僅是學習一門技術,更是學習一種解決分布式信任問題的思維方式。

評分

拿到這套書,我真的像是挖到寶藏一樣!作為一個對區塊鏈充滿好奇,但又苦於技術門檻太高的普通愛好者,這本書簡直就是為我量身打造的。我一直想深入瞭解區塊鏈背後的原理,但市麵上很多書要麼過於理論化,要麼過於淺顯,難以找到一個平衡點。這套書的齣現,徹底改變瞭我的看法。首先,它並非簡單羅列概念,而是從最核心的算法入手,將那些看似晦澀難懂的加密學、共識機製等等,拆解得極其清晰。讀完算法部分,我感覺自己像是打通瞭任督二脈,對於比特幣、以太坊這些大傢耳熟能詳的名字,有瞭全新的認識。我不再隻是停留在“聽說過”,而是能隱約理解它們是如何運作的。然後,順著算法的脈絡,開發指南更是讓我躍躍欲試。它並沒有迴避實際操作的細節,而是手把手地教你如何搭建環境、如何編寫智能閤約、如何進行部署。這對於我這種想動手實踐但又怕無從下手的人來說,簡直是福音。我試著跟著書中的例子寫瞭一個簡單的代幣,那種從無到有、從零到一的成就感,是無法用言語來形容的。更重要的是,它培養瞭我獨立解決問題的能力,遇到問題時,我知道在哪裏可以找到綫索,如何去思考。

相關圖書

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2025 book.teaonline.club All Rights Reserved. 圖書大百科 版權所有